Regulation and Investor Protection

We could not confirm authorization from any tier-one regulator such as the FCA, ASIC, CySEC, or BaFin. Realdot operates without verifiable regulatory authorization, leaving clients without the compensation schemes, capital requirements, and complaint channels that licensed brokers must maintain.

Without strong regulation, traders typically have no compensation fund, no independent dispute resolution, and very limited ability to recover money if the platform stops cooperating.

Withdrawal Policies and Fund Access

Withdrawal problems are among the most common complaints associated with high-risk brokers, and realdot review discussions frequently raise them. Warning patterns reported across similar operators include:

  • Sudden requests for additional fees, taxes, or ‘verification’ payments before release
  • Unresponsive support once funds are requested
  • Repeated delays or ‘pending’ withdrawal statuses
  • Minimum-volume or bonus ‘turnover’ rules that block payouts
  • Accounts frozen after a withdrawal request

No broker is entirely risk-free, but the issues raised in this realdot review are serious. Before trusting any platform with your money, investors should:

  • Verify the regulatory entity directly with the authority
  • Test withdrawals with a small amount first
  • Understand leverage and all fees
  • Keep complete records of deposits and communications
  • Avoid adding funds under pressure
